How access actually works in Columbia

Most Columbia families who find the right program first talk to a clinician whose incentives are not commercial. The second-best path is the SAMHSA federal helpline (1-800-662-HELP), which routes without a financial incentive. Cold-calling Columbia facility admissions lines is productive but slow, and the answers differ depending on who picks up the phone.

Practical next steps

What consistently works better in Columbia than cold-calling admissions: clinical assessment first, benefits verification in writing second, facility selection third. In that order. Reversing is the most common source of the "they said they took my insurance but I got a $15,000 bill" stories.
